In Japan at whatever period of the year a child is born, whether in January or December, it is said to be one year old on January 1 the following year. So one birthday serves for all. On the grave of Rudyard Kipling in Poet’s Corner, Westminster Abbey, was laid recently a wreath and a card, which read: “In afefetionate remembrance of Mr Kipling’s kindness to the Hon. G. Howard Ferguson, former High Commissioner for Canada, and J. W. Barrv, Toronto.’’
